What shampoo should I use to wash a 3-month-old kitten? - in detail

When considering the grooming needs of a 3-month-old kitten, it is essential to choose a shampoo that is gentle and specifically formulated for young felines. Kittens at this age have delicate skin and a sensitive immune system, making it crucial to avoid harsh chemicals that could cause irritation or adverse reactions. Opt for a shampoo that is free from artificial fragrances, dyes, and parabens. These ingredients can be particularly harmful to young kittens.

One of the best options for a 3-month-old kitten is a specially formulated kitten shampoo. These products are designed to be mild and non-irritating, ensuring that they are safe for use on young kittens. Look for shampoos that are labeled as "kitten-safe" or "gentle formula." These shampoos often contain natural ingredients such as oatmeal, aloe vera, and chamomile, which can soothe the skin and provide a gentle cleansing action.

Additionally, it is important to consider the pH balance of the shampoo. Kittens have a different pH balance compared to adult cats, and using a shampoo that is not pH-balanced for kittens can lead to skin issues. Always check the product label to ensure that the shampoo is pH-balanced for kittens.

When bathing a 3-month-old kitten, it is advisable to use lukewarm water and limit the bath time to avoid chilling or overheating the kitten. Gently wet the kitten's fur, apply a small amount of shampoo, and lather it in carefully, avoiding the eyes, ears, and mouth. Rinse thoroughly to remove all traces of shampoo, as residue can cause skin irritation. After bathing, pat the kitten dry with a soft towel and ensure that it is kept in a warm environment to prevent hypothermia.
